## Runbook: Bouncekeeper stalls

So the bounce processor (Bouncekeeper) eats delivery failure reports and flags bad addresses. When it stalls, you'll usually see the pending-bounce count climbing on the Fernmouth dashboard. First, restart the worker — honestly, that fixes it 80% of the time. If not, check whether the suppression-list service is rejecting writes; it gets grumpy under load. To poke it manually, hit the internal suppression API with curl. You'll need its service key for that, pasted below.

gateway credential: kto23_LX9A4ys6i4nzHtpOLNLodKK

## Receipt Mailer Overview

Welcome aboard! The Kindlepost mailer turns completed donations into PDF receipts and emails them within a few minutes. It's queue-driven: one worker renders, another sends, and a janitor retries failures. Most knobs you'll care about live in one config block rather than scattered through the code, and they're shown below.

tuning table, yajog-yahof:
BUDGETS = {
    "lamvan": 303,
    "wenox": 460,
    "fenvan": 525,
}

Subject: Tracing setup for the Quillbrook integration

Hi, and welcome aboard. As you wire your services into the Quillbrook mesh, please propagate our trace header on every outbound call, including retries — dropped headers are the main reason spans appear orphaned in the Lanternview dashboard. Sampling is set to 20% in staging, so don't panic if some requests vanish. To query the trace API directly while you're validating your integration, authenticate with the token below.

login token, yagaf-hawip: eyJhbGciOiJIUzI1NiIsInR5cCI6IkpXVCJ9.eyJzdWIiOiIdHjlcNIn0.AFyH-u9q